Cahill in the Pink!
Everton, who were unfortunate not to gain that first win at Fulham last weekend, move out of the bottom three and have plenty of time to challenge for the top-six place which is their annual target. It also may be a sign of things to come that the team was able to win away from home in their new, bright pink, away strip, which causes most of their fans to wear sunglasses at each game it is used. If the strip is going to have that kind of effect, they should wear it everywhere... it's not as if anyone else has anything like it!
